Perched in a fantastic location overlooking the sea, beach and countryside in Angle near Pembroke, Pembrokeshire is North Studdock Cottage. This delightful, dog-friendly holiday home benefits from a wonderful interior completed by four beautifully-appointed bedrooms and a wonderful wrap-around garden boasting panoramic views of both the coast and countryside; the perfect choice for families or friends looking for a coastal escape in Pembrokeshire. Utilise the off-road parking for four cars before stepping inside, straight into the spacious living/dining room; here you can unwind on the plush sofa in front of the electric-flame-effect stove before making a start on dinner. Head into the fully-equipped kitchen to rustle up a tasty meal that the whole family can enjoy around the dining table; after dinner, head outside to marvel at the picturesque views across the coast. When stars fill the sky over head, travel back inside to wash off the day’s adventures in the bathroom before choosing one of four bedrooms to slope off to sleep in; there is a ground-floor king-size with en-suite, a king-size with en-suite, a king-size and a single with pull out trundle bed. If you can tear yourself away from this breath-taking setting, venture down to West Angle Beach where you can while away sunny days on its golden shores or join the Pembrokeshire Coast Path for more stunning views across the Atlantic and other beautiful beaches including Freshwater West which may look familiar to Harry Potter fans. After a day of adventure, treat your loved ones to a delicious meal at The Hibernia Inn (0.5 mile) or The Old Point House (1.2 miles) which overlooks Angle Bay. The Wavecrest café in West Angle bay also provides delicious home cooked food during the day. Venture further inland to tour the historic town of Pembroke home to the breath-taking Pembroke Castle where Henry VII was born and Monkton Old Hall. Continue learning about the area’s history at the Pembroke Dock Heritage Centre in Pembroke Dock where you can also join a boat tour to try your hand at finishing or explore the canals on canoes.
